Discover the Best AdHitz Alternative for Monetizing Your Website

AdHitz offers a straightforward way to sell ad space on your website, allowing you to define the details and then integrate a simple code. It verifies the code's placement, enabling advertisers to purchase ad slots. However, for various reasons – perhaps you're seeking more features, better monetization options, or different platform compatibility – exploring an AdHitz alternative is a smart move. This guide will help you navigate the top contenders in the ad-serving space.

Google AdSense

Google AdSense

Google AdSense is a widely popular, free web-based program that empowers website publishers to display relevant Google ads and earn revenue. It's a fantastic AdHitz alternative because it allows unlimited sites with just one account, making it incredibly scalable for publishers of all sizes. While it doesn't list specific features, its strength lies in its extensive network and ease of use.

DoubleClick for Publishers

DoubleClick for Publishers

DoubleClick for Publishers, now known as Google Ad Manager, is a powerful yet easy-to-use ad management solution designed for growing publishers. As a free web-based platform, it serves as an excellent AdHitz alternative for those needing more robust ad management capabilities beyond simple ad space selling. It's ideal for publishers looking to manage multiple ad networks and direct deals efficiently.

OKO

OKO

OKO focuses on increasing ad earnings by fostering competition among major ad networks and exchanges for your ad impressions. This free Software as a Service (SaaS) platform makes it a compelling AdHitz alternative for publishers aiming to optimize their ad revenue without the hassle of managing multiple relationships themselves.

Media.net

Media.net

Media.net, in partnership with the Yahoo! Bing Network, helps publishers increase advertising revenue through contextual ads, reaching over 100 million unique users. This free web-based platform is an excellent AdHitz alternative for publishers looking to tap into a different, yet significant, ad network for their monetization efforts.
